You do not need a therapist if you own a motorcycle, any kind of motorcycle!
—Dan Aykroyd
On a motorcycle, you can’t really think about more than where you are. There’s a freedom that comes with that —from stress, worry, sweating the small stuff.
—Laurence Fishburne
Note to self: Never ride a motorcycle in stilettos and a miniskirt.
—Maggie Grace
The perfect man? A poet on a motorcycle.
—Lucinda Williams
When I’m riding my motorcycle, I’m glad to be alive. When I stop riding my motorcycle, I’m glad to be alive.
—Neil Peart
There is something about the sight of a passing motorcyclist that tempts many automobile drivers to commit murder.
—Hunter S Thompson
Motorcycle adventures are the perfect antidote to middle age.
—Alex Morritt
I asked God for a bike, but I know God doesn’t work that way. So I stole a bike and asked for forgiveness.
—Emo Philips
A motorcycle is an independent thing.
—Ryan Hurst
That’s all the motorcycle is, a system of concepts worked out in steel.
—Robert M Pirsig
If I could marry my motorcycle, I’d roll her right up to the altar.
—Flip Wilson
You live more for five minutes going fast on a bike than other people do in all of their life.
—Marco Simoncelli
